Roman RadermacherRoman Radermacher, age 65, formerly of Grant County, died Wednesday, March 9, 2016, at Golden Living Center in Lake Norden, SD.

Roman was buried beside his family at the St. Charles Catholic Cemetery in Big Stone City on Friday, March 18, 2016, with Father Brian Oestreich conducting graveside services.

Roman Radermacher was born on September 20, 1950, in Ortonville, MN. He was the son of Casper and May (Fox) Radermacher. Roman’s parents were married in Australia and immigrated to the United States, settling in Big Stone City. They had two children: Marie, born in 1947, and Roman. Both children had developmental disabilities and lived at several care centers throughout the years. Roman lived at Redfield State Hospital and School as well as Atco in Watertown. He currently resided in Lake Norden.

Roman loved Coke a Cola soda and adored hugs. He was a trickster and had a way of making people smile. He was very humorous and always had a smile for everyone he met. Roman made friends wherever he was and will be dearly missed.

Roman was preceded in death by his parents, Casper and May; and his sister, Marie.
